CreateResourceDefinition
CreateResourceDefinition(CustomFieldType, ExtendedAttributeResource, string)
Fabrieksmethode die een eenvoudige uitgebreide attribuutdefinitie creëert, die Microsoft Project weergeeft als “Geen”. Het heeftCalculationType
is gelijk aanNone en kan alleen in Resource worden gebruikt. U bent verplicht om op te gevencustomFieldType ,fieldId Enalias wanneer deze methode wordt aangeroepen.
public static ExtendedAttributeDefinition CreateResourceDefinition(CustomFieldType customFieldType,
ExtendedAttributeResource fieldId, string alias)
Parameter | Type | Beschrijving |
---|---|---|
customFieldType | CustomFieldType | De opgegevenCustomFieldType type. |
fieldId | ExtendedAttributeResource | De opgegevenExtendedAttributeResource veld ID. |
alias | String | De opgegevenString alias. |
Winstwaarde
Gemaakt exemplaar van deExtendedAttributeDefinition
klasse met opgegevencustomFieldType ,fieldId Enalias.
Voorbeelden
Gebruik dit voorbeeld om een aangepaste tekstvelddefinitie te maken:
var resourceTextAttr = ExtendedAttributeDefinition.CreateResourceDefinition(CustomFieldType.Text, ExtendedAttributeResource.Text27, "My custom field");
project.ExtendedAttributes.Add(resourceTextAttr);
Zie ook
- enum CustomFieldType
- enum ExtendedAttributeResource
- class ExtendedAttributeDefinition
- naamruimte Aspose.Tasks
- montage Aspose.Tasks
CreateResourceDefinition(ExtendedAttributeResource, string)
Fabrieksmethode die een eenvoudige uitgebreide attribuutdefinitie creëert, die Microsoft Project weergeeft als “Geen”. Het heeftCalculationType
is gelijk aanNone en kan alleen in Resource worden gebruikt. U bent verplicht om op te gevenfieldId Enalias wanneer deze methode wordt aangeroepen. Het veldtype wordt afgeleid uit veld-id.
public static ExtendedAttributeDefinition CreateResourceDefinition(
ExtendedAttributeResource fieldId, string alias)
Parameter | Type | Beschrijving |
---|---|---|
fieldId | ExtendedAttributeResource | De opgegevenExtendedAttributeResource veld ID. |
alias | String | De opgegevenString alias. |
Winstwaarde
Gemaakt exemplaar van deExtendedAttributeDefinition
klasse met opgegevenfieldId Enalias.
Voorbeelden
Gebruik dit voorbeeld om een aangepaste tekstvelddefinitie te maken:
var resourceTextAttr = ExtendedAttributeDefinition.CreateResourceDefinition(ExtendedAttributeResource.Text27, "My custom field");
project.ExtendedAttributes.Add(resourceTextAttr);
Zie ook
- enum ExtendedAttributeResource
- class ExtendedAttributeDefinition
- naamruimte Aspose.Tasks
- montage Aspose.Tasks